Abstract
Following the turmoil and political fragmentation of the Third Intermediate Period, a family of rulers from Sais, in an extraordinary story of adroit diplomacy and military activity, reunited Egypt into a single state. For nearly a hundred and forty years Egypt was once again ranked as a major power and under Saite rule Egypt entered a period of economic prosperity and cultural revival.
